AppLoader liberta você das limitações do protocolo e lhe permite testar as coisas que você quer. Crie fluxos de trabalho personalizados com facilidade usando scripts enlatados e tempo de log-in e defina fluxos de trabalho que se ajustem à sua carga de trabalho. Você pode carregar seus APIs SOAP e REST, microserviços e bancos de dados usando o LoadUI Pro, que faz parte da oferta ReadyAPI do SmartBear.

  • Configure o teste adicionando usuários de teste, tateamento, navegador, localização, alimentação de dados falsificados, condições de rede, e muito mais.
  • No entanto, muitas partes mecânicas não são facilmente acessíveis para inspeção, sendo recomendável realizar testes adicionais para estabelecer a condição do OLTC.
  • Identifique o número médio ideal de usuários que podem usar simultaneamente o produto e, em seguida, identifique o número máximo de usuários simultâneos durante um evento de estresse pesado.
  • Embora os testes de carga sejam vitais antes do lançamento do produto, não é uma solução “one and done”.
  • Em vez disso, os testes de carga devem tornar-se parte das práticas ágeis e automatizadas da organização.

O teste de pico também pode dar uma visão de como um programa ou aplicativo responde entre picos de atividade. Com base nesses requisitos, selecione uma plataforma de teste de carga capaz de realizar todos os aspectos dos testes que deseja realizar. Uma vez que você tenha se familiarizado com a plataforma de teste de sua escolha, você pode projetar scripts ou cenários que simulam com precisão os casos de uso definidos. Alguns cenários podem simular usuários reais no sistema, enquanto outros podem simplesmente gerar grandes quantidades de solicitações GET simultâneas.

Métricas Específicas de Hardware-Specific Metrics

JMeter é uma plataforma de teste de desempenho de código aberto da Apache projetada especificamente para testes de carga de aplicativos web. O JMeter não funciona no nível do navegador, ele simplesmente funciona no nível do protocolo. Embora pareça um navegador da perspectiva do servidor web, ele não pode executar todas as ações que um navegador poderia executar, como realmente renderizar a página e executar JavaScript. JMeter é bom para gerar solicitações em um site de muitos usuários simultâneos durante o teste de carga. Uma distinção importante do JMeter é que ele envia usuários virtuais para o seu site ou aplicativo web a partir do seu próprio computador, portanto, você não pode coletar dados de tráfego do mundo real como você pode com o LoadView.

  • Recomenda-se colocá-los perto de elementos estruturais firmes, evitar áreas cheias de gás e procurar um local abaixo do nível de óleo do transformador.
  • Os testes de desempenho podem ser automatizados usando várias soluções de terceiros.
  • Muitas vezes, uma equipe de QA, DevOps ou às vezes até mesmo marketing é responsável por carregar testes de seus sites ou aplicativos web.
  • Deve ser definida deacordo com a necessidade individual de cada projeto, e é através dela que são determinadasas prioridades dos testes que serão realizados.
  • Portanto, as ferramentas de teste de carga livre podem não ser gratuitas, considerando os custos envolvidos na configuração do teste.

Se uma interface de usuário está em constante mudança, pode não ser prático para configurar e executar testes automatizados, porque você estaria constantemente alterando os testes em si. O teste de componentes individuais isola partes individuais de um sistema, como Testador de software: Descubra as principais responsabilidades e o melhor curso de QA um serviço web ou uma chamada de banco de dados, e realiza vários testes nesse componente fora do resto do sistema. O teste de componentes também pode testar apenas um aspecto de um sistema, como uma pesquisa de banco de dados ou uma gravação de banco de dados.

WebLOAD

Seu gravador baseado em proxy também registra suas atividades HTTP e gera testes em JavaScript. WebLOAD oferece relatórios de análise de dados de desempenho que ajudam os usuários a identificar gargalos. Os https://mundodelivros.com/testador-de-software/ são um subconjunto de testes de desempenho utilizados para software, websites, aplicações, e sistemas relacionados. É um teste não funcional que simula o comportamento de vários utilizadores que acedem ao sistema simultaneamente. O processo de desenvolvimento de software requer extensos testes contínuos, principalmente testes ágeis, para ajudar a garantir um desempenho eficiente e previsível.

Medir o desempenho das características e funcionalidades fundamentais do software ajuda você a tomar decisões informadas e planejar sua estratégia comercial na configuração do software. A criação de um documento orientador é a primeira fase do desenvolvimento de um caso de teste de carga. O seu plano de teste de carga não precisa de ser complicado, mesmo uma lista de pontos de bala pode ser útil, mas deve delinear os componentes essenciais do teste do início ao fim. Ao sujeitar um servidor a um grande volume de tráfego, uma organização empresarial pode determinar se a sua infra-estrutura é suficiente para qualquer expansão futura. Os testes do servidor são também uma parte essencial da manutenção de um sítio web que funcione bem. Os testes de carga de impressora envolvem o envio de um número crescente de trabalhos para a fila de impressão.

Conclusão: Qual é a melhor ferramenta de teste de carga?

As ferramentas de teste de desempenho funcionam realizando ações em um site ou aplicativo e registrando os resultados. Muitas métricas diferentes podem ser gravadas por uma ferramenta de teste, como tempos de carga de página, tempo para interagir e capacidade de resposta do usuário. Um teste de pico é um tipo específico de teste de desempenho que realiza um número crescente de solicitações simultâneas, a fim de simular grandes picos de tráfego em um sistema. Um teste spike pode ser usado para testar a carga de uma API ou aplicativo para gargalos durante períodos de rápido crescimento ou alto número de usuários simultâneos. O objetivo do teste de pico é detectar e analisar anormalidades dentro do software ou aplicativo à medida que a demanda é subitamente aumentada ou diminuída. A realização de testes de pico antes que um alto número de usuários simultâneos atinja um site ou aplicativo pode identificar os gargalos que podem fazer com que o site ou o aplicativo diminuam ou caiam.

testes de carga